January 17, 2021 at 10:27 am #1203988039Most Volpi Cup Best Actress winners with a english language performance got nominated for the Oscar:
2002 – Julianne Moore (Far From Heaven)
2004 – Imelda Staunton (Vera Drake)
2006 – Helen Mirren (The Queen)
2007 – Cate Blanchett (I’m Not There)
2016 – Emma Stone (La La Land)
2018 – Olivia Colman (The Favourite)
2020 – Vanessa Kirby (Pieces of A Woman)
Vanessa ain’t missing the nomination.
